Transaction 5b91e17c2484c521ca51b50dc9aabe8c68acb25f4243aebe92e2b5073f320a4d

1 Input
2 Outputs
  • 5b91e17c2484c521ca51b50dc9aabe8c68acb25f4243aebe92e2b5073f320a4d:0
  • value  19072663
    address  3PE6Q5Rjd3LckqbhDwHX8UkMds8twzdByp
  • 5b91e17c2484c521ca51b50dc9aabe8c68acb25f4243aebe92e2b5073f320a4d:1
  • value  1000389051
    address  bc1qnagz4dsyhzmsncr43vxsq5gnpavze2z90v8ed7